PRICE v. J & H MARSH & McLENNAN, INC.

Docket No. 07-0651-cv.

493 F.3d 55 (2007)

Andrew N. PRICE, E. James Drollette, John A. Sullivan, Jr., Anthony Von Elbe, Champlain Enterprises, Inc., Plaintiffs-Appellees, v. J & H MARSH & McLENNAN, INC., Defendant-Third-Party-Plaintiff-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Second Circuit.

Decided: July 6,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jonathan P. Wolfert, Kaplan, Thomashower & Landau LLP, New York, N.Y., submitted papers on behalf of Defendant-Third-Party-Plaintiff-Appellant.

Douglas C. Pierson, Pierson Wadhams Quinn Yates & Coffrin, Burlington, VT, submitted papers on behalf of Plaintiffs-Appellees.

Before: NEWMAN, MINER and KATZMANN, Circuit Judges.


JON O. NEWMAN, Circuit Judge.

This appeal primarily concerns the issue of the appealability of an order remanding a removed action to state court. Specifically, we must decide whether we have appellate jurisdiction to review (1) a remand order based on the conclusion that joinder of a plaintiff destroyed subject matter jurisdiction and (2) the ruling that permitted joinder of a plaintiff after removal.
